I sanded the poop out of the chrome...
Primed them,
Then used 5 LIGHT coats of factory matched duplicolor.
LIGHTLY sanded (400 grit) between color coats.
Then applied 3 LIGHT coats of clear coat.

I am in the process of working on my badges....

Having really bad luck so far.
Had to sand past the chrome, past the nickle, and the plastic is really delicate underneath....
Used bondo to fill in the the "black stripe groove" as I wanted a smooth emblem...
